1. From NASCAR Champion to Devoted Father

Dale Jr.’s Racing Legacy

For decades, Dale Earnhardt Jr. was one of the most dominant and beloved figures in NASCAR. His career highlights include:

✔ 26 career NASCAR Cup Series victories
✔ Two Daytona 500 wins (2004, 2014)
✔ Fifteen consecutive Most Popular Driver awards (2003-2017)
✔ 2021 NASCAR Hall of Fame inductee

Yet, despite his incredible accomplishments on the track, it was something off the track that changed his life forever—the birth of his daughter.

The Birth of Isla Rose Earnhardt

In April 2018, Dale Jr. and his wife Amy Earnhardt welcomed their first child, Isla Rose Earnhardt. It was a moment that transformed him in ways he never expected.

Balancing Work and Fatherhood

Even after retiring from full-time racing, Dale Jr. remains heavily involved in NASCAR through:

✔ NBC Sports broadcasting – He provides expert analysis during NASCAR races.
✔ JR Motorsports – His race team competes in the NASCAR Xfinity Series.
✔ The Dale Jr. Download podcast – A hit show where he shares stories from his racing career.

3. Dale Jr.’s Emotional Connection to His Late Father

Remembering Dale Earnhardt Sr.

Dale Jr. grew up in the shadow of his father, the legendary Dale Earnhardt Sr., a seven-time NASCAR champion who tragically passed away in a crash during the 2001 Daytona 500.

One of the biggest regrets of Dale Earnhardt Sr.’s life was that he didn’t spend enough time with his family. He was so focused on racing that he often missed important moments at home.
